According to the Integrated Taxonomic Information … WebDescription of the Rat. This species is a relatively large rodent with brownish fur, short legs, and a long scaly tail. Their underside coloration typically ranges between cream and light brown. Most adults measure about 15 in. long, including their tails. The largest individuals weigh about a pound, but domestic lab Rats sometimes exceed this ...

Web13 jan. 2024 · The ZCAM veterinarians shared five things you might not know. Rats are smart, empathetic, and kind of adorable. Good problem solvers, rats can be trained to do a variety of tricks and play with their owners. In studies, rats have shown empathy, forgoing treats to help fellow rats. Web5 mei 2024 · In the UK, You can find most fancy rats selling for 10-15 British pounds which will be worth $14-20 dollars at most pet stores. Private breeders are asking as much as 70 British pounds for special Dumbo rats or special breeds. For Canadians, fancy rats are just as popular and will range from $5-20 CAD which is $4-16 per fancy rat.

Both Norway rats and roof rats are considered Old World rats, as they came to the U.S. from Europe. A Washington Department of Fish and Wildlife factsheet explains the social and family structure of these rats: Old World rats travel 50 to 300 feet from their nests to look for food and water and patrol their territory.
